The four principal tests for insanity are:

  1. M'Naghten Rule: This test determines if the defendant was unable to understand the nature of their act or distinguish right from wrong due to a severe mental disease.
  2. Irresistible Impulse Test: This examines whether the defendant was unable to control their actions or conform their conduct to the law due to a mental disorder.
  3. Durham Rule: This rule links criminal behavior directly to a mental illness, asserting that a defendant is not criminally responsible if their unlawful act was a product of mental illness.
  4. Model Penal Code Test: This combines elements of the M'Naghten and Irresistible Impulse tests, stating that a person is not responsible if, due to mental illness, they lack substantial capacity to appreciate the criminality of their conduct or conform to the law.

What is the oldest test of insanity in the US legal system?

The "M'Naghten Rule" is one of the oldest tests of insanity in the US legal system, dating back to 1843. It states that a defendant is legally insane if, at the time of the crime, they did not know the nature of their actions or did not know what they were doing was wrong.
